Resolute Holdings Management, Inc.

Resolute Holdings Management, Inc. is a U.S.-based management company organized to provide operating management services to businesses it controls or manages, with a focus on generating recurring management fees. It was formed in 2024 and is structured to support operating companies in the United States and internationally through its Resolute Operating System and capital allocation expertise.
